Types of Exercise Bicycles Before diving into the specifics of choosing an exercise bicycle, it's vital to comprehend the various types offered on the marketplace: Upright Bicycles Description: These resemble traditional outside bikes with a more upright riding position. Advantages: Ideal for those who want a more intense exercise, as they engage the core and upper body muscles in addition to the legs. Best For: Cardiovascular physical fitness, weight loss, and muscle toning. Recumbent Bicycles Description: Recumbent bikes include a reclined seating position with back assistance. Benefits: Easier on the joints and back, making them suitable for people with movement issues or those recovering from injuries. Best For: Low-impact workouts, rehab, and comfy, longer rides. Spin Bicycles Description: Designed to imitate the experience of road cycling, these bikes are often utilized in high-intensity interval training (HIIT) and spin classes. Benefits: Excellent for constructing strength and endurance, with the capability to adjust resistance for diverse workouts. Best For: Intense cardio sessions, muscle structure, and group fitness classes. Hybrid Bicycles Description: Combine features of upright and recumbent bikes, offering a well balanced riding experience. Benefits: Versatile for a wide variety of exercises, ideal for both newbies and advanced users. Best For: General fitness, variety in workouts, and users who want a mix of comfort and strength. Secret Features to Consider When looking for an exercise bicycle, a number of functions can make a significant difference in your workout experience and general satisfaction: Resistance Mechanism Magnetic Resistance: Smooth and peaceful, with adjustable levels to differ the strength of your workout. Air Resistance: Utilizes a fan to create resistance, which increases as you pedal faster. Good for imitating outside riding conditions. Friction Resistance: Uses a belt or pad to create resistance, however can be less smooth and more noisy compared to magnetic options. Frame and Build Quality Look for a strong, well-constructed frame that can support your weight and hold up against regular use. Consider the product, such as steel or aluminum, which affects the weight and durability of the bike. Adjustability Seat: Ensure the seat is comfortable and adjustable to fit your height and chosen riding position. Handlebars: Adjustable handlebars can boost convenience and permit different riding styles. Console and Features Display: A clear, easy-to-read screen that tracks metrics such as speed, range, calories burned, and heart rate. Pre-programmed Workouts: Some bikes include integrated exercise programs to keep your routine diverse and engaging. Q: What is the distinction between an upright and a recumbent bicycle? A: Upright bicycles have a more traditional riding position, comparable to outside bikes, and are better for intense workouts and core engagement. Recumbent bikes provide a reclined seating position with back support, making them more comfy and ideal for low-impact workouts and people with back or joint issues. Q: Are spin bicycles just for indoor biking classes? A: No, spin bikes are flexible and can be utilized for a variety of exercises, consisting of solo sessions. They are designed to mimic roadway biking and provide a high-intensity exercise experience. Q: How much area do I need for an exercise bicycle? A: The space required differs by design, however normally, you need to have at least 6 feet of clearance in front of the bike and 2 feet on either side. Procedure the dimensions of the bike and the offered area to make sure a good fit. Q: Can I monitor my heart rate with an exercise bicycle? A: Many exercise bikes feature heart rate monitoring functions, either through contact sensors on the handlebars or through wireless chest straps. Examine the specs of the bike you have an interest in to see if it consists of these features. Q: How often should I clean my exercise bicycle? A: It's suggested to clean your exercise bicycle after every usage to keep hygiene and performance. Utilize a damp cloth to clean down the seat, handlebars, and other surface areas. Routine maintenance, such as lubricating moving parts and inspecting for loose bolts, is also important. Q: What is the best exercise bicycle for weight-loss? A: Upright and spin bicycles are generally best for weight loss due to their capability to offer high-intensity workouts that burn more calories.
